Undergraduate Degrees and CurriculumBachelor of Music in Jazz Studies For the student seeking a professional career in jazz and related fields of contemporary music. The curriculum includes weekly private lessons in both jazz and classical music, courses in jazz improvisation, theory, arranging, composition, jazz history, and jazz keyboard skills, plus integrally related courses like sound reinforcement and recording, digital recording and editing, electronic music, and the business of music. There are supportive courses in classical music theory, musicianship, music history, secondary piano, and conducting, as well as a wide choice of theory, history, ethnic and world music electives. General studies in English and academics round out the degree to provide a comprehensive education. Bachelor of Music in Music Education with an Additional Specialization in Jazz For the student wishing a degree leading to licensure to teach public school music, pre-kindergarten through 12. (This license is reciprocal with 44 other states.) The student takes many of the same courses as Jazz Studies Majors plus Music Education requirements. Double Major in Music Education and Jazz Studies Includes all the requirements of both the B.M. in Music Education and the B.M. in Jazz Studies. This course of study generally takes five years to complete. Bachelor of Arts with a Major in Music For the student wishing to pursue a more liberal arts oriented program of studies while maintaining their concentration in music. Jazz courses and private lessons in jazz and classical music are available as part of the B.A. in Music degree.
